Linux Mint Cinnamon vs. Linux Mint Xfce

What's the Difference?

Linux Mint Cinnamon and Linux Mint Xfce are both popular desktop environments offered by the Linux Mint operating system. Cinnamon is known for its sleek and modern design, with a focus on providing a user-friendly experience. On the other hand, Xfce is a lightweight desktop environment that is highly customizable and offers a more minimalistic approach. While Cinnamon may be more visually appealing, Xfce is preferred by users looking for a faster and more efficient system. Ultimately, the choice between the two comes down to personal preference and the specific needs of the user.

Customization and Appearance

Linux Mint Cinnamon is known for its sleek and modern appearance, with a polished user interface that resembles the traditional Windows desktop. It offers a wide range of customization options, allowing users to personalize their desktop with different themes, icons, and applets. On the other hand, Linux Mint Xfce is more lightweight and minimalistic in design. It may not have as many customization options as Cinnamon, but it offers a clean and simple interface that is easy to navigate.

Performance and Resource Usage

When it comes to performance and resource usage, Linux Mint Xfce is the clear winner. Xfce is a lightweight desktop environment that is designed to be fast and efficient, even on older hardware. It consumes less system resources compared to Cinnamon, making it a great choice for users who prioritize performance over visual aesthetics. On the other hand, Cinnamon is more resource-intensive and may not run as smoothly on older or low-spec systems.

Features and Functionality

Linux Mint Cinnamon comes with a wide range of features and functionality that are designed to enhance the user experience. It includes a powerful window manager, a customizable panel, and a variety of desktop effects. Cinnamon also offers built-in support for desktop widgets and applets, allowing users to add additional functionality to their desktop. In comparison, Linux Mint Xfce is more focused on simplicity and efficiency. It may not have as many advanced features as Cinnamon, but it provides a stable and reliable desktop environment for everyday use.

Software and Applications

Both Linux Mint Cinnamon and Linux Mint Xfce come with a pre-installed set of essential applications, such as a web browser, office suite, and media player. However, Cinnamon may offer a slightly larger selection of software out of the box, including some multimedia and gaming applications. Xfce, on the other hand, is more lightweight and may not include as many pre-installed applications. Users can easily install additional software from the Software Manager in both desktop environments.
